Rapper T.I. knocks Rihanna off US No.1

His track 'Whatever You Like' climbs from 71 to No.1 this week thanks to strong digital sales - the biggest leap to the top in US chart history.
Rihanna's 'Disturbia' slips to second place, with Chris Brown's 'Forever' holding steady in third.
Meanwhile, Pink scores her ninth US top ten hit with new single 'So What', which makes an impressive debut at No.9.
Elsewhere, Leona Lewis's 'Better In Time' continues to scale the Billboard Hot 100, climbing from 33 to 28 this week.
The top ten in full (click where possible for our reviews):
1. (71) T.I.: 'Whatever You Like'
2. (1) Rihanna: 'Disturbia'
3. (3) Chris Brown: 'Forever'
4. (4) Katy Perry: 'I Kissed A Girl'
5. (7) Kardinal Offishall ft. Akon: 'Dangerous'
6. (6) M.I.A: 'Paper Planes'
7. (5) Coldplay: 'Viva La Vida'
8. (9) Ne-Yo: 'Closer'
9. (-) Pink: 'So What'
10. (8) Rihanna: 'Take A Bow'
